How to Input Your Information: Step-by-Step Instructions
To get accurate results, you'll need three key pieces of information: annual mileage, vehicle fuel efficiency (MPG), and current fuel prices in your area.
Step 1: Calculate Your Annual Mileage
Most drivers underestimate their annual mileage. Here's how to calculate it accurately:
Method 1 - Odometer Check: Record your current odometer reading and check it again after one month. Multiply the difference by 12 for your annual estimate.
Method 2 - Daily Tracking: Track your daily driving for one week, including:
- Commute to work (round trip)
- Weekend errands and activities
- Occasional longer trips
Multiply your weekly total by 52, then add estimated vacation and long-distance travel.
Method 3 - Insurance Records: Check your auto insurance policy or renewal documents, which often include annual mileage estimates.
Step 2: Find Your Vehicle's Fuel Efficiency
For existing vehicles, check these sources for accurate MPG ratings:
- Vehicle window sticker (new cars)
- Owner's manual specifications
- EPA.gov fuel economy database
- Your vehicle's trip computer average
For vehicles you're considering, use EPA ratings but remember that real-world efficiency can vary by 10-20% based on driving conditions, weather, and maintenance.
Step 3: Determine Local Fuel Prices
Input current fuel prices in your area:
- Gas vehicles: Use regular unleaded prices unless your vehicle requires premium
- Electric vehicles: Calculate your electricity rate per kWh (check your utility bill)
- Hybrids: Use regular gas prices (most hybrids use regular unleaded)
Gas prices can vary significantly by region and over time, so use current local prices for the most accurate estimate.

Real-World Examples and Scenarios
Here are practical examples showing how different drivers can use the calculator to make informed decisions.
Example 1: The Daily Commuter
Scenario: Sarah drives 22,000 miles annually (long commute) and is comparing a 28 MPG sedan versus a 45 MPG hybrid.
Calculator Inputs:
- Annual mileage: 22,000 miles
- Gas price: $3.40/gallon
- Vehicle 1: 28 MPG sedan
- Vehicle 2: 45 MPG hybrid
Results:
- Sedan annual fuel cost: $2,671
- Hybrid annual fuel cost: $1,661
- Annual savings with hybrid: $1,010
Analysis: The hybrid saves Sarah over $1,000 annually. If the hybrid costs $3,000 more upfront, she'll break even in less than three years and save thousands over the vehicle's lifetime.
Example 2: The Weekend Driver
Scenario: Mike drives only 8,000 miles annually and is considering whether a hybrid is worth the extra cost.
Calculator Inputs:
- Annual mileage: 8,000 miles
- Gas price: $3.40/gallon
- Vehicle 1: 26 MPG SUV
- Vehicle 2: 38 MPG hybrid SUV
Results:
- Regular SUV annual fuel cost: $1,046
- Hybrid SUV annual fuel cost: $716
- Annual savings with hybrid: $330
Analysis: Mike saves only $330 annually with the hybrid. If it costs $4,000 more upfront, the payback period exceeds 12 years, making the hybrid financially questionable for his low-mileage driving.
Example 3: Electric Vehicle Consideration
Scenario: Lisa drives 15,000 miles annually and is comparing a 30 MPG gas car versus an electric vehicle.
Calculator Inputs:
- Annual mileage: 15,000 miles
- Gas price: $3.40/gallon
- Gas vehicle: 30 MPG
- Electric rate: $0.12/kWh (3.5 miles per kWh efficiency)
Results:
- Gas vehicle annual fuel cost: $1,700
- Electric vehicle annual cost: $514
- Annual savings with EV: $1,186
Analysis: Lisa saves nearly $1,200 annually with an electric vehicle. Even with a $8,000 higher upfront cost, she'll break even in about 7 years and save significantly thereafter.
Advanced Tips for Maximizing Your Savings
Beyond choosing the right vehicle, several strategies can reduce your fuel costs regardless of what you drive.
Optimize Your Driving Habits
Aggressive driving can reduce fuel efficiency by 15-30%. Implement these fuel-saving techniques:
- Accelerate gradually and maintain steady speeds
- Anticipate traffic flow to avoid unnecessary braking
- Use cruise control on highways when appropriate
- Remove excess weight from your vehicle (every 100 pounds can reduce efficiency by 1-2%)
- Keep windows closed at highway speeds (use A/C instead)
Maintain Your Vehicle Properly
Poor maintenance can reduce fuel efficiency by 10-40%. Follow these maintenance tips:
- Replace air filters every 12,000-15,000 miles
- Keep tires properly inflated (check monthly)
- Use the recommended grade of motor oil
- Address engine issues promptly (check engine lights often indicate efficiency problems)
- Keep up with regular tune-ups according to manufacturer recommendations
Consider Hybrid and Electric Options Strategically
Hybrids make the most financial sense for: High-mileage drivers, city driving (stop-and-go traffic), and drivers who want fuel savings without lifestyle changes.
Electric vehicles work best for: Drivers with predictable daily routes under 200 miles, access to home or workplace charging, and those prioritizing lowest operating costs.
Common Mistakes to Avoid When Using the Calculator
Accurate inputs are crucial for meaningful results. Here are the most common errors that lead to incorrect calculations.
Underestimating Annual Mileage
Many drivers guess low on annual mileage, which underestimates fuel costs and skews comparisons. Track your actual driving for at least a month rather than estimating.
Using EPA Ratings Without Adjustments
EPA ratings represent laboratory conditions. Real-world efficiency is typically 10-20% lower due to weather, traffic, and driving habits. Consider adjusting EPA ratings downward for more realistic estimates.
Ignoring Fuel Price Variations
Fuel prices fluctuate significantly over time and by location. Use current local prices and consider that gas prices can vary by $0.50/gallon or more between regions.
Forgetting Total Cost of Ownership
The calculator focuses on fuel costs, but don't ignore other factors like maintenance, insurance, and depreciation. Electric vehicles often have lower maintenance costs, while luxury vehicles typically have higher insurance and depreciation costs.
Making Your Final Decision: Beyond Fuel Costs
While fuel costs are important, they're just one component of total vehicle ownership expenses. Consider these additional factors in your decision.
Upfront Cost vs. Long-Term Savings
Calculate the payback period for more expensive, fuel-efficient vehicles:
Payback Period = (Higher Purchase Price) ÷ (Annual Fuel Savings)
Generally, payback periods under 5-6 years make financial sense, especially if you plan to keep the vehicle long-term.
Infrastructure and Convenience Factors
For electric vehicles, consider:
- Access to home charging
- Availability of public charging in your area
- Range requirements for your longest regular trips
For hybrids, note that they require no infrastructure changes and can use any gas station.
Incentives and Tax Credits
Research available incentives:
- Federal tax credits for electric vehicles (up to $7,500)
- State and local rebates
- Utility company incentives for EV purchases
- HOV lane access for hybrids and EVs in some areas
